LUDLOW

SO5174 BULL RING 825-1/1/174 (East side) 15/04/54 No.26

GV II

Formerly known as: No.31 BULL RING. House, now offices. C18. Painted stucco; plain tile gable roof. 3-storeys; 2-window range: 6/6 sashes in beaded cases: late C19, 3/3 sashes over. Late C20 shopfront with recessed entrance to right. Rear: brick with two C19 and C20 lights in altered openings under segmental arches; storey band; early C19 casement. 2 short stacks visible on right side.
